Alternatively, if your residence exudes rustic charm, a stamped or textured finish can mimic the look of natural stone or wood, seamlessly blending with the surrounding landscape.

Incorporating Color and Patterns: Infuse personality into your concrete patio by incorporating color and patterns that resonate with your home's style. Neutral hues like soft grays or warm browns provide a timeless backdrop that complements any architectural motif. To add visual interest, consider incorporating decorative patterns or borders that echo elements found in your home's façade or interior design scheme.

Creating Defined Spaces: Transform your concrete patio into a multifunctional oasis by delineating distinct areas for dining, lounging, and entertaining. Utilize decorative concrete techniques such as staining or scoring to delineate these spaces, ensuring a cohesive flow that seamlessly integrates with your landscaping. By creating designated zones, you can optimize the functionality of your outdoor area while maintaining visual harmony with your home's aesthetic.

Integrating Greenery and Landscaping: Embrace Nashville's lush landscape by integrating greenery and landscaping elements into your concrete patio design. Strategically placed planters, raised flower beds, or trellises can add bursts of color and texture, softening the hardscape and infusing natural beauty into your outdoor retreat. Select plants and foliage that complement the architectural style of your home, whether it's native wildflowers for a cottage-inspired vibe or sculptural succulents for a modern twist.

Adding Ambient Lighting: Extend the enjoyment of your concrete patio into the evening hours by incorporating ambient lighting that enhances the overall atmosphere. Illuminate walkways with discreet path lights or install LED strips along the perimeter for a subtle glow. Consider incorporating statement fixtures such as pendant lights or sconces to create focal points and enhance the architectural elements of your outdoor space. By layering different lighting sources, you can create a warm and inviting ambiance that complements your home's style.

Accessorizing with Furniture and Décor: Complete the look of your concrete patio with carefully curated furniture and décor that reflects your personal taste and lifestyle. Choose outdoor furnishings that echo the design aesthetic of your home, whether it's sleek and contemporary or rustic and cozy. Layer plush cushions, throw pillows, and outdoor rugs to add comfort and warmth, while incorporating decorative accents such as lanterns, sculptures, or artwork to infuse personality into your outdoor retreat.

Maintaining Consistency with Materials: Maintain visual cohesion by selecting materials for your concrete patio that harmonize with existing elements found throughout your home and landscaping. Choose complementary materials for features such as retaining walls, fire pits, or pergolas to create a unified design palette. Whether you prefer natural stone, wood, or metal accents, integrating consistent materials will create a cohesive look that ties your outdoor space to the architectural character of your Nashville residence.
